How do you choose the right FSM platform for your trade business?

Start with a hard list of must-haves before you open a single demo. The platforms that look impressive in a sales call often fall apart on the three or four things your crew actually needs every day.

Must-have features for trade businesses:

  1. Offline read and write on mobile (not just view-only)
  2. Credential and certification enforcement at the job-assignment level
  3. Parts and inventory capture tied to work orders
  4. QuickBooks or payroll integration that syncs without manual export
  5. First-time-fix tools: job history, asset records, and parts availability visible before dispatch

Nice-to-have (evaluate after must-haves are confirmed):

  • Customer-facing booking portals
  • Route optimization beyond basic GPS
  • Custom reporting dashboards
  • Warranty and contract management

Numbered demo questions to ask every vendor:

  1. "Show me a technician completing a work order with no cell signal." Watch whether the app writes locally and syncs on reconnect, or just shows an error.
  2. "Walk me through what happens when a job is reassigned mid-day." A good platform handles this in two taps; a bad one requires a dispatcher to manually rebuild the job.
  3. "What are your SLA penalties if sync is delayed more than 15 minutes?" Vendors with no answer to this question have no contractual accountability for uptime.
  4. "Show me how a credential check fires when I assign a tech to a job that requires EPA 608 certification." If the platform can't demonstrate this, it doesn't do it.
  5. "Give me a real integration example with QuickBooks Online, including what happens to a failed sync." Vague answers here mean manual reconciliation in your future.

Red flags that should stop a trial:

  • Sync delay longer than 60 seconds on a standard connection
  • No credential or certification check at dispatch
  • Pricing that changes based on "modules" not listed upfront
  • Integration requires a third-party middleware vendor the FSM company doesn't support

Work orders and asset tracking

Job history tied to a specific asset (a unit's service record, warranty status, prior parts used) is what separates a first-time-fix from a callback. ServiceMax and IFS Field Service Management are the strongest here for complex asset-intensive environments. Inventory and invoicing

Parts-level cost capture at the job is where most small FSM platforms fall short. The technician selects a part, the work order records the cost, and the invoice generates automatically. That loop, when it works, eliminates the end-of-day reconciliation that costs office staff hours every week. Reporting and automation

First-time-fix rate, technician utilization, and average job duration are the three metrics that tell you whether your FSM is working. Platforms that surface these without custom report builds are worth paying more for. Automated customer notifications (ETA texts, job-complete confirmations) reduce inbound calls by a measurable amount and are table stakes in 2026.

Pro Tip: Ask every vendor to show you their first-time-fix report without any custom configuration. If it takes more than three clicks to pull, your dispatchers won't use it under pressure.

Hidden costs to watch for

  • Data migration from your existing system (often $2,000–$10,000+ for mid-size businesses)
  • Custom workflow configuration billed at hourly consulting rates
  • Per-API-call fees for accounting integrations
  • Training and onboarding packages sold separately from the base subscription
  • Annual price escalators buried in multi-year contracts

Deployment timelines

Business sizeTypical timelineKey milestones
1–10 techs1–2 weeksSetup, data import, 1 training session, go-live
10–50 techs4–8 weeksPilot with 2–3 techs, phased rollout, integration testing
50+ techs / enterprise3 monthsDiscovery, configuration, integration, UAT, phased go-live

Deployment timelines for FSM by business size

A 10-tech HVAC business on a seat-based platform should budget for the monthly subscription, a one-time data migration, and roughly two to four hours of onboarding time per technician. Trial checklist to validate mobile and AI dispatch claims:

  • Put the device in airplane mode and complete a full work order (parts, photos, signature). Reconnect and confirm sync.
  • Assign a job to a technician who lacks the required certification. Does the system flag it or allow it silently?
  • Simulate a mid-day reschedule with three active jobs. Measure how many steps the dispatcher takes.
  • Pull a first-time-fix report without custom configuration. Time how long it takes.
  • Ask the vendor to show ETA accuracy on a live or recorded dispatch day.

Three pilot metrics to track during a 30–60 day trial:

  1. First-time-fix rate. Baseline it before the trial starts. A well-matched dispatch system should move this number within the first month.
  2. Job-matching accuracy. Track how often the AI recommendation matches the tech you would have chosen manually. Divergences reveal either a data quality issue or a platform limitation.
  3. Admin hours saved per week. Count dispatcher and office staff hours spent on scheduling, invoicing reconciliation, and customer calls before and after go-live.

The one thing most FSM rollouts get wrong

Most trade businesses evaluate FSM platforms the wrong way. They sit through a polished demo, get impressed by a dashboard, and sign a contract before anyone has tested what happens when a technician is in a basement with no signal and a customer waiting upstairs.

The platforms that win in practice are not always the ones with the most features. They are the ones your technicians actually use. That sounds obvious, but the graveyard of failed FSM rollouts is full of expensive platforms that looked great in a conference room and got abandoned in the field within 60 days.

Two lessons from real deployments stand out. First, phase your rollout. Start with three to five technicians who are willing to give honest feedback, not your most compliant crew members. The friction they surface in week one is cheaper to fix than the friction your whole team discovers in month three. Second, credential enforcement at dispatch is not a nice-to-have for electrical and HVAC businesses. It is the difference between a compliant job and a liability. If your platform doesn't check certifications before assigning a tech, you are one audit away from a problem.

One warning: scope creep during implementation is the biggest budget killer in FSM deployments. Every "small customization" a vendor offers during onboarding adds time, cost, and complexity. Get the core workflows running first. Add customization only after your team has used the base product for 60 days and can tell you specifically what they need.
